Parametric Amplifier

Advanced

Parametric Amplifier is a low-noise microwave device that boosts faint quantum signals from qubits for high-fidelity measurement, without adding significant noise that would corrupt the information.

In Plain English

Imagine trying to hear a very faint whisper across a noisy room. A standard microphone amplifies the whisper but also all the background noise, making it hard to understand. A parametric amplifier is like a special listener that only captures and boosts the whisper's specific frequency, effectively ignoring the surrounding noise. This allows you to clearly hear the original faint message.
